What Your Experience Includes
Bulldog - you sit side by side with your instructor. Your activity starts with a cup of tea or coffee on arrival and then you are kitted out into flying suits with name badges, military bone-domes and gloves. Next it's time to get to know your aircraft with a safety brief at the aircraft in which you will be told about the cockpit controls. During your pre-flight briefing, lasting approximately 45 minutes, you will cover a safety/parachute brief, how to fly the aircraft, aerobatics and an introduction to air combat manoeuvres. You will also be shown a short video. Moving onto your personal sortie pre-brief with your instructor pilot, you will discuss your flight preferences and then it's time to strap on your parachute and take to the skies. You will sit side by side with your instructor. During your 35 minutes (25 minutes airborne) in the aircraft you will learn the following techniques:
- Take-off and `get to know´ the aeroplane effects of controls
- turning, climbing and descending
- Aerobatics introduction - as mild or wild as you want
- Student `hands on stick´ time (e.g. loop, aileron roll etc)
- Return to Base
After exiting the aircraft and your personal debrief with the instructor pilot, your experience will come to an end with your flight certificate being signed. Only now can you catch your breath.
Group Size: Your aerobatics flight is just for you and the pilot.
How long does it last ?
You will have approximately 2 to 3 hours at the venue with approximately 35 minutes in aircraft.

Restrictions
The maximum weight is 17 stone and the maximum height is 6'5".
To participate in this activity you need to be at least 12 years old.
You will be asked to sign an indemnity and acceptance of conditions which includes a medical self-certification. If over 55, you will be required to hand over a letter from your doctor confirming your suitability to fly.
